B0959:06 Code -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le Circuit Low Voltage/Open
Quick Answer
The parking assist sensors are 3-wire ultrasonic sensors that are used to determine the distance between the vehicle and an object. Common causes include Faulty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le,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le harness is open or shorted,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le circuit poor electrical connection. Severity is Low - monitor the vehicle and repair when practical. The vehicle can usually be driven if no severe symptoms are present, but symptoms should be checked before extended driving.

Code B0959:06 Description
What are the Possible Causes of the DTC B0959:06?
- Faulty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le
-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le harness is open or shorted
-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le circuit poor electrical connection
- Faulty Parking Assist Control Module
How to Fix the DTC B0959:06?
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?
Labor: 1.0
To diagnose the B0959:06 code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80β$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about B0959:06 Code
What does OBDII code B0959:06 mean?
Code B0959:06 indicates a low voltage or open circuit issue in the Parking Assist Rear Sensor Left Middle, which affects the functionality of the parking assist system.
What are the common symptoms of code B0959:06?
Symptoms include the parking assist system not functioning properly, warning lights or messages on the dashboard, and difficulty detecting obstacles behind the vehicle.
What causes code B0959:06 to appear?
Common causes include damaged wiring, loose or corroded connectors, a faulty parking sensor, or issues with the control module.
Can I still drive my car with code B0959:06?
Yes, the vehicle can still be driven, but the parking assist system may not work, increasing the risk of collisions when reversing.
How do I diagnose code B0959:06?
Start by inspecting the wiring and connectors for damage or corrosion, then test the parking sensor for functionality using a multimeter or diagnostic tool.
How can I fix code B0959:06?
Repairs may involve replacing damaged wiring, cleaning or reconnecting corroded connectors, or replacing the faulty parking sensor entirely.
How much does it cost to fix code B0959:06?
Repair costs can vary but typically range from $50 to $200, depending on whether you need to replace the sensor or repair wiring.
